Output 3d8140fac31bea20ecb219d5f35be08f605e7359ca3b7207273d614c9918d29e:1

value
26946154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d2c5aa719d84bb04e3f62a112bfd1b8d1d3fcb0 OP_EQUALVERIFY OP_CHECKSIG
address
1CQrbkt2rhiC1MjfYBBGK27zuiT5NA2hdM
transaction
3d8140fac31bea20ecb219d5f35be08f605e7359ca3b7207273d614c9918d29e
spent
true